Marks and Spencer is recalling Plant Kitchen No Chicken and Chorizo Sandwich because it contains egg which is not mentioned on the label. This means the product is a possible health risk for anyone with an allergy or intolerance to egg. This product was recalled in the... See More United Kingdom

- Affected product:
Plant Kitchen No Chicken and Chorizo Sandwich, Use by: 06 September 2023

If you have bought the above product and have an allergy or intolerance to egg do not eat it. Instead return it to your nearest store for a full refund.

In case you experienced harm from allergens or undeclared ingredients, it is important to report it. It can help to detect & resolve issues and prevent others from being harmed, and it enables better surveillance. If symptoms persist, seek medical care.

Company name: Marks and Spencer
Product recalled: Plant Kitchen No Chicken and Chorizo Sandwich
FSA Recall date: 09/04/2023

Source: food.gov.uk

RappelConso announced the recall of Isigny Sainte-Mère Trésor d'Isigny cheese due to the presence of Listeria monocytogenes. This product was distributed nationwide in France.

The recalled product is:
- Isigny Sainte-Mère Trésor d'Isigny cheese, 150 g, GTIN 3254550070236 Lot C1911. Use-by date 09/03/2023.

Packaging: Wooden plate and... See More plastic film
Marketing date: 07/28/2023
End of marketing: 08/30/2023
Storage temperature: Keep refrigerated.
Health mark: FR 14.342.001 CE
Geographical area of sale: Entire France
Distributors: LECLERC, CARREFOUR, CARAMELS D'ISIGNY, INTERMARCHE
Published on: 09/06/2023
Recall End Date: 09/19/2023

If you have the recalled product in your home, please do not consume it.

In case you are experiencing Listeria monocytogenes symptoms such as high fever, severe headache, stiffness, nausea, abdominal pain, and diarrhea, it is important to report it. It can help to detect & resolve outbreaks early and prevent others from being harmed, and it enables better surveillance. If symptoms persist, seek medical care.

Source: rappel.conso.gouv.fr

Funbel Ventures Ltd is recalling OLA-OLA Authentic Pounded Yam because it contains milk and sulphites which are not mentioned on the label. This means the product is a possible health risk for anyone with an allergy or intolerance to milk or milk constituents and/or a sensitivity to... See More sulphur dioxide and/or sulphites. This product was recalled in England and Scotland.

-Affected product:
OLA-OLA Authentic Pounded Yam, Pack size: (1.8kg, 4.5kg, 907g), Batch code: All batch codes, Best before: All dates from 2020, Allergens: Milk, Sulphur dioxide and/or sulphites.

If you have bought the above product and have an allergy or intolerance to milk or milk constituents and/or a sensitivity to sulphur dioxide and/or sulphites, do not eat it. Instead return it to the store from where it was bought for a full refund with or without a receipt.

In case you experienced harm from allergens or undeclared ingredients, it is important to report it. It can help to detect & resolve issues and prevent others from being harmed, and it enables better surveillance. If symptoms persist, seek medical care.

Company name: Funbel Ventures Ltd
Product recalled: OLA-OLA Authentic Pounded Yam
FSA Recall date: 08/29/2023

Source: food.gov.uk

RappelConso announced the recall of Whole cooked shrimp label rouge 40/60 -Madagascar due to the presence of Listeria monocytogenes. This product was distributed nationwide in France.

The recalled product is:
- Whole cooked shrimp label rouge 40/60 -Madagascar sold to customers and retail stores from 08/23/2023 to... See More 09/04/2023. GTIN 3700156964160 Lot 323511. Use-by date 09/04/2023.

Packaging: Shrimp sold in trays
Marketing date: 08/24/2023
Marketing end date: 08/27/2023
Storage temperature: Store in the refrigerator
Geographical area of sale: Entire France
Distributors: TIBIDY + Retail (Viviers de Saint-Colomban)
Published on: 09/13/2023
Recall End Date: 09/23/2023

If you have the recalled product in your home, please do not consume it.

In case you are experiencing Listeria monocytogenes symptoms such as high fever, severe headache, stiffness, nausea, abdominal pain, and diarrhea, it is important to report it. It can help to detect & resolve outbreaks early and prevent others from being harmed, and it enables better surveillance. If symptoms persist, seek medical care.

Source: rappel.conso.gouv.fr
